Abstract:
Intravenous drug users (IDUs) face high risks for blood-borne viral infections due to needle-sharing practices, driving community transmissions. This cross-sectional epidemiological study investigated the seroprevalence, specific sub-genotypic distributions, and risk factors of Hepatitis B Virus (HBV) infection among commercial intravenous drug users in urban settings. Blood samples from 350 IDUs were screened for Hepatitis B surface Antigen (HBsAg) using a third-generation Enzyme-Linked Immunosorbent Assay (ELISA), and positive samples were analyzed via real-time PCR for genotypic characterization. Structured questionnaires captured demographic data and injection risk behaviors. The overall seroprevalence of HBsAg in this cohort was 18.3% (64/350). Active HBV replication (HBV DNA positivity) was confirmed in 78.1% (50/64) of the seropositive individuals. Genotypic mapping revealed that genotype E predominated at 68.0% (34/50), followed by genotype A at 22.0% (11/50) and genotype D at 10.0% (5/50). Multivariate logistic regression analysis identified several independent risk factors associated with HBV seropositivity: a history of sharing needles or syringes (OR = 3.8, 95% CI = 1.9–7.6, p < 0.001), a duration of intravenous drug use > 3 years (OR = 2.9, 95% CI = 1.4–5.9, p < 0.01), and a concurrent history of commercial sex work (OR = 2.4, p < 0.05). HBV genotype E infection is common among intravenous drug users, reflecting a high burden of behavioral risk factors. Expanding targeted community harm-reduction programs, implementing needle-exchange initiatives, and providing free HBV vaccination campaigns are critical interventions.
